Distribution centre — 850kW rooftop system
An 850kW rooftop solar system across a refrigerated distribution centre, sized to the site's daytime load profile and delivered without interrupting despatch operations.

The challenge
The site ran high daytime refrigeration and materials-handling loads with electricity as its single largest controllable operating cost. Roof space was available but shared with plant, and any works had to avoid disruption to a 24/6 despatch schedule.
Our approach
- 1
Interval-data analysis to match array size to on-site consumption rather than export.
- 2
Roof structural assessment and panel layout designed around existing plant and access paths.
- 3
Network application and compliance documentation managed end-to-end.
- 4
Installation sequenced by roof zone, with live switching works outside despatch hours.
- 5
Monitoring configured so generation and consumption are verifiable month to month.
Outcomes achieved
850 kW
System size
~55%
Daytime load offset
Nil
Operational downtime
Live, verified
Monitoring
- Majority of daytime consumption now supplied on site, reducing exposure to peak tariffs.
- Measurable emissions reduction reported against a verified pre-installation baseline.
- No interruption to despatch operations during delivery.
- Monitoring platform handed over to the site team for ongoing reporting.
